jquery 防止表单重复提交代码


Posted in Javascript onJanuary 21, 2010

我的解决办法如下(只针对客户端):
用户点击提交按钮后给按钮添加disabled属性

$("input:submit").each(function() { 
var srcclick = $(this).attr("onclick"); 
if(typeof(srcclick)=="function"){ 
$(this).click(function() { 
if (srcclick()) { 
setdisabled(this); 
return true; 
} 
return false; 
});} 
}); 
function setdisabled(obj) { 
setTimeout(function() { obj.disabled = true; }, 100); 
}
Javascript 相关文章推荐
jQuery EasyUI 中文API Button使用实例
Apr 14 Javascript
JSON序列化与解析原生JS方法且IE6和chrome测试通过
Sep 05 Javascript
jQuery及JS实现循环中暂停的方法
Feb 02 Javascript
关于获取DIV内部内容报错的原因分析及解决办法
Jan 29 Javascript
Angular4 Select选择改变事件的方法
Oct 09 Javascript
Angular4.x Event (DOM事件和自定义事件详解)
Oct 09 Javascript
node.js使用http模块创建服务器和客户端完整示例
Feb 10 Javascript
详解如何修改 node_modules 里的文件
May 22 Javascript
如何在postman测试用例中实现断言过程解析
Jul 09 Javascript
完美解决vue 中多个echarts图表自适应的问题
Jul 19 Javascript
解决element-ui的下拉框有值却无法选中的情况
Nov 07 Javascript
Vue实现简单购物车功能
Dec 13 Vue.js
javascript 哈希表(hashtable)的简单实现
Jan 20 #Javascript
JS 对象介绍
Jan 20 #Javascript
JavaScript 学习笔记(十一)
Jan 19 #Javascript
9个JavaScript评级/投票插件
Jan 18 #Javascript
jQuery Flash/MP3/Video多媒体插件
Jan 18 #Javascript
使用IE6看老赵的博客 jQuery初探
Jan 17 #Javascript
jQuery+CSS 实现的超Sexy下拉菜单
Jan 17 #Javascript
You might like
php下实现伪 url 的超简单方法[转]
2007/09/24 PHP
php截取字符串函数substr,iconv_substr,mb_substr示例以及优劣分析
2014/06/10 PHP
PHP信号量基本用法实例详解
2016/02/12 PHP
PHP实现的敏感词过滤方法示例
2019/03/06 PHP
extjs关于treePanel+chekBox全部选中以及清空选中问题探讨
2013/04/02 Javascript
一个css与js结合的下拉菜单支持主流浏览器
2014/10/08 Javascript
JQuery中Ajax()的data参数类型实例分析
2015/12/15 Javascript
JavaScript实现阿拉伯数字和中文数字互相转换
2016/06/12 Javascript
AngularJS轻松实现双击排序的功能
2016/08/30 Javascript
分享JS代码实现鼠标放在输入框上输入框和图片同时更换样式
2016/09/01 Javascript
AngularJS入门教程之与服务器(Ajax)交互操作示例【附完整demo源码下载】
2016/11/02 Javascript
JavaScript实现的XML与JSON互转功能详解
2017/02/16 Javascript
JS对象序列化成json数据和json数据转化为JS对象的代码
2017/08/23 Javascript
react-native 圆弧拖动进度条实现的示例代码
2018/04/12 Javascript
KOA+egg.js集成kafka消息队列的示例
2018/11/09 Javascript
JavaScript创建对象方式总结【工厂模式、构造函数模式、原型模式等】
2018/12/19 Javascript
小程序rich-text组件如何改变内部img图片样式的方法
2019/05/22 Javascript
Js通过AES加密后PHP用Openssl解密的方法
2019/07/12 Javascript
使用layui实现的左侧菜单栏以及动态操作tab项方法
2019/09/10 Javascript
基于layui框架响应式布局的一些使用详解
2019/09/16 Javascript
vue vantUI tab切换时 list组件不触发load事件的问题及解决方法
2020/02/14 Javascript
详解vue或uni-app的跨域问题解决方案
2020/02/21 Javascript
JS+JQuery实现无缝连接轮播图
2020/12/30 jQuery
Python yield使用方法示例
2013/12/04 Python
Python实现的三层BP神经网络算法示例
2018/02/07 Python
Python实现繁?转为简体的方法示例
2018/12/18 Python
解决Python下json.loads()中文字符出错的问题
2018/12/19 Python
HTML5本地存储之IndexedDB
2017/06/16 HTML / CSS
2014信息技术专业毕业生自我评价
2014/01/17 职场文书
初中三好学生自我鉴定
2014/04/07 职场文书
食品科学与工程专业毕业生求职信范文
2014/07/21 职场文书
2014年国庆节演讲稿
2014/09/02 职场文书
2015年学校安全工作总结
2015/04/22 职场文书
2015年秋季小学开学典礼主持词
2015/07/16 职场文书
导游词之太行山青龙峡
2020/01/14 职场文书
python如何正确使用yield
2021/05/21 Python